> "Jim" said in news:1618c01c41687$7c5a5f70$a101280a@phx.gbl:
>> Recently installed a new drive but I did not remove old
>> C: drive first (old drive nfg)New drive formatted as F:
>> but now I can't rename it. The problem now is that I need
>> to install some software patches, but they will only
>> install on C: If possible, how do I rename F: to C:
>
> Run diskmgmt.msc and reassign the drive letters. You cannot reassign
> one drive to a drive letter that is inuse, so you'll have to first
> reassign the other drive so you can usurp its old drive letter.

Forgot to mention. If you installed when the drive was F: but is now C:, applications may not run or you cannot find some data files. That's because their full path got recorded in their config files or in the registry. You'll have to search for their references and change F: to C:. Search the registry for "F:\" to find them. Do a file search to look for "F:\" to find the config files unless you can find them yourself, like maybe they are in the same path as where the application got installed.
